Abstract: The present invention relate to systems and methods for conducting secured telephony and transaction authentication via electronic devices. More specifically, the embodiments of the present invention relate to systems and methods for conducting secure networked telephony, including but not limited to communications over the internet, other computer networks, wired or wireless networks, or audio, video or multi-media.
Abstract: Systems and methods of the present invention monitor and manage network devices on a network. More specifically, network architecture is graphically represented in 3-dimensional space. Moreover, the 3-dimensional architecture of the network is mapped and/or overlaid onto a 3-dimensional graphical representation of physical space and displayed on a visual display. In addition, intrusion detection is graphically represented onto the three-dimensional graphical representation of the network architecture.
